How many centimeters are equal to 0.4 inches? Remember, 2.54 cm = 1 in.
Enter you number as a decimal and round to the nearest hundredth. 
Answer:
1.016 cm
Step-by-step explanation:
1 inch = 2.54 cm
0.4 inch = 2.54 * 0.4 cm = 1.016 cm

If 8 people invest each in a stamp collection and after a year the collection is worth $3,800, how much did each person lose? show work
This question is incomplete, the complete question is;
If 8 people invest $500 each in a stamp collection and after a year the collection is worth $3,800, how much did each person lose? show work
Answer:
Each person lost $25
Step-by-step explanation:
Given the data in the question;
Number people that invested = 8
Amount each invested = $500
worth after a year the collection = $3,800
Now, the amount each person lost will be;
[tex]Lost_{each-person[/tex] = Total loss / total number of persons
[tex]Lost_{each-person[/tex] = [ ( 500 × 8 ) - 3800 ] / 8
[tex]Lost_{each-person[/tex] = [ 4000 - 3800 ] / 8
[tex]Lost_{each-person[/tex] = 200 / 8
[tex]Lost_{each-person[/tex] = 25
Therefore, each person lost $25

What is an equation of the line that passes through the points (4, -1) and
(-8, –7)?
Answer:
y=1/2x-3
Step-by-step explanation:
m=(y2-y1)/(x2-x1)
m=(-7-(-1))/(-8-4)
m=(-7+1)/-12
m=-6/-12
m=1/2
y-y1=m(x-x1)
y-(-1)=1/2(x-4)
y+1=1/2x-4/2
y=1/2x-2-1
y=1/2x-3

Determine whether the distribution below represents a probability distribution.
x
P(x)
3
-.3
6
.5
9
.1
12
.3
15
.4
Answer:
No, not a probability distribution.
Step-by-step explanation:
It appears that one of the probabilities in the table (-.3) is negative, which is not allowed.

The length, l, that a spring is stretched varies directly as the amount of force, F, applied to the end of the spring. When a force of 10 pounds is applied to a spring, it stretches 3 inches. How much will the same spring stretch if the force is increased to 15 pounds?
A.
8 inches
B.
7.5 inches
C.
4.5 inches
D.
2 inches
Answer:
C. 4.5 inches
Step-by-step explanation:
Given the following data;
Force, F = 10 pounds
Extension, e = 3 inches
First of all, we would determine the spring constant (k) using the following formula;
Force = spring constant * extension
10 = spring constant * 3
Spring constant = 10/3
Spring constant = 3.33 pounds per inches.
Next, we would find the extension of the spring when a force of 15 pounds is applied;
F = ke
15 = 3.33 * e
Extension, e = 15/3.33
Extension, e = 4.5 inches.

WILL GIVE BRAINLIEST anitas and caseys bills do not vary from month to month. anita pays 80 more than casey does each month. over the course of 4 months,their combined bill is 1,520. write the system of equations that describes this situation and solve it to find the montly payments for anita and casey.
Answer:
1520/4=380 per month
Step-by-step explanation:
The monthly payments for Anita and Casey are 230 and 150.
What is equation?"An equation is a formula that expresses the equality of two expressions consisting of variables and/or numbers, by connecting them with the equals sign =."
Assume
Monthly payments for Anita = x
Monthly payments for Casey = y
We have
Anita pays 80 more than Casey does each month.
We can write the equation
x = y + 80
x - y = 80 ...........................(1)
Over the course of 4 months, their combined bill is 1,520.
We can write the equation
4x + 4y = 1520...................(2)
Solving equations (1) and (2) by substituting equation x = y + 80 in equation (2)
⇒4x + 4y = 1520
⇒4(y + 80) + 4y = 1520
⇒4y + 320 + 4y = 1520
⇒8y = 1520-320
⇒8y = 1200
⇒y = [tex]\frac{1200}{8}[/tex]
⇒y = 150
Substitute y = 150 in equation (1)
⇒x - y = 80
⇒x - 150 = 80
⇒x = 80+150
⇒x = 230
Hence, the monthly payments for Anita and Casey are 230 and 150.
